Webb10 juli 2024 · Photo: Jean-Pol Grandmont / CC 3.0. Also known as the Monterrey white oak, the Mexican white oak is a fast-growing, medium-sized tree that is green almost year-round. It is drought-tolerant and adapts well to an urban setting. At maturity, the Mexican white oak will grow to 40 feet in height with a rounded crown. Webb31 jan. 2012 · In urban and suburban landscapes, tree selection is typically based on two criteria: (1) fast growth to provide quick shade on sparse new home sites and (2) small to medium mature size to accommodate small lot sizes. Many trees are advertised as “fast growing,” yet mature size is not often advertised by the seller or inquired into by the buyer.

Chinese Pistache. Pistache chinensis. Large tree. Deciduous shade tree with beautiful orange to red fall color. Slow to moderate growth. Webb16 sep. 2024 · Common name: Green Ash. Latin name: Fraxinus pennsylvanica Type of tree: Deciduous Size at maturity: 18m tall, 12m spread Growth rate: Medium to fast Best growing conditions: Full sun, moist soil Things to love: An extremely hardy tree; will grow in clay soil and survive extreme climates. Southern Magnolia (Magnolia grandiflora) – Northern & Southern California. Images by Fern Berg, Own Work, for Tree Vitalize. One of the most common evergreen shade trees in SoCal is the Southern Magnolia. They are capable of growing between 1 to 2 ft a year.

WebbAsimina triloba. Pawpaw is a forest understory tree native to much of the eastern US, reaching its western limit in the oak-hickory forests of southeast Nebraska. It is best known for its large, edible, yellow-green fruits with custard-like pulp. It’s occasionally used as a landscape tree in southeast Nebraska.
